Admins 06-22-2001 07:28 AM

Graal is made in Delphi 4 Standard version,
3 years ago it was 70$ so it shouldn't be
too expensive :-)
The good thing is that making windows, buttons
etc. is very simple, so in that way it is similar to
visual basic. But the program is much faster
(almost as fast as C++) and it compiles the whole
Graal in less than 3 seconds, good for testing :-)

It's probably a good thing to start, you will
also find many components for Delphi on the
web (components - things you can put onto
windows like buttons or a DirectX control).

If you are a hardcore-programmer you might
need to switch, because Microsoft always releases
stuff for C++ first, also most source code for Linux
is C++, and if you want to make games for consoles
there are almost only C/C++ compilers.
